(WING) reported Q1 2026 earnings per share (EPS) of $1.18, substantially exceeding the consensus estimate of $1.0508 by 12.3%. Revenue figures were not disclosed in the release. Despite the pronounced earnings beat, the stock slipped 0.75% in after-hours trading, suggesting that investors may have anticipated an even larger surprise or are weighing longer-term cost pressures.

Wingstop’s Q1 2026 earnings performance underscores the company’s continued operational strength. The 12.3% EPS surprise likely reflects robust same-store sales growth, driven by effective digital marketing, expanded delivery partnerships, and the popularity of limited-time offers. The asset-light franchise model continues to support margin expansion, as royalty and advertising fees scale with system-wide sales while franchisees absorb most commodity and labor cost volatility. In recent quarters, Wingstop has emphasized domestic unit growth and international expansion, which may have further boosted royalty revenue. Additionally, technology investments—such as the order-ahead app and loyalty program—appear to be driving higher check sizes and frequency. However, the absence of reported revenue leaves some ambiguity about top-line trends. The company’s ability to maintain a double-digit earnings surprise despite a challenging macroeconomic environment suggests effective cost controls and pricing power. Investors will be watching for any updates on food-cost inflation and how it might affect franchisee profitability going forward. Guidance for the remainder of fiscal 2026 was not explicitly provided in the earnings announcement. However, management may have signaled expectations for continued same-store sales growth in the low-to-mid single-digit range, consistent with past trends. Strategic priorities likely include accelerating domestic franchise development, entering new international markets, and deepening the digital ecosystem to capture more off-premise occasions. Wingstop’s leadership has previously highlighted the potential for store count to surpass 7,000 globally over the long term. Risk factors that could temper these ambitions include rising labor costs, potential supply chain disruptions, and increased competition from other fast-casual chicken concepts. The company’s high dependence on chicken wings also exposes it to commodity price volatility. Any sudden spike in wing costs could pressure franchisee margins and slow unit growth. Additionally, consumer spending shifts toward value-oriented dining may affect ticket averages. While the EPS beat provides near-term confidence, cautious language from management during the conference call may temper growth expectations.
